MEN'S TENNIS TRUCKS TO 6-0 RECORD WITH WIN OVER KING

BRISTOL, TENN. — The UVA Wise men's tennis team kept their win streak going as they defeated the King Tornado today in a swift 6-1 triumph at the King University Tennis Complex today, Oct. 9.

In doubles, the Cavs (6-0) found no trouble against King (0-1) opponents — as Miguel De Rueda and Gustavo Marangoni took home the 6-3 No. 1 win and Vanja Vojinovic and Dominik Thuri-Nagy squeezed out a 7-5 win at No. 2. Dominic Hoffman and Fabian Segrada were able to take a win due to a King no-player in the No. 3 spot.

Singles play wasn't a difficult task for the Cavs either, as their squad only lost one singles matchup at No. 2.

King fell behind two quickly as they had two no-players at No. 5 and No. 6. Thuri-Nagy, Marangoni, and Vojinovic brought home the gold against King's Alex Sodre, Andre Schiabel and Mat Viera at No. 1, No. 3, and No. 4 to solidify a 6-1 overall win.

With the win, the UVA Wise men's tennis squad sits at 6-0 and mark their best record since 2015-16 (the Cavs went 11-9 in the 2015-16 season).
